How Do Agreement surety Bonds Work?



Exactly how precisely do agreement surety bonds work? When you become part of a contract, a surety bond functions as a warranty that you'll accomplish your responsibilities.

You, the contractor, protect a bond from a surety firm, which reviews your financial stability and job experience. This bond typically includes three events: you, the job proprietor, and the surety.

If you fall short to satisfy the agreement requirements, the surety steps in to compensate the job proprietor, up to the bond amount. You're then in charge of compensating the surety.

This system safeguards project owners and makes sure that you're held accountable for your job. Comprehending this process helps you browse your obligations and the potential monetary effects more effectively.
